Definition of Lubricity
Noun: lubricity loo'bri-si-tee
- Feeling morbid sexual desire or a propensity to lewdness
- prurience, pruriency, lasciviousness, carnality
- Freedom from friction; the property of reducing friction (e.g. providing oiling effect); slipperiness
